Donald Trump made headlines after making his unexpected broadcasting debut during the Commanders vs. Lions game. From the booth, he humorously said, “I’d love to have your job someday,” sparking jokes about a possible new career path. The former president also made history as the first sitting president to attend a regular-season NFL game in nearly five decades. His surprise appearance blurred the lines between politics, sports, and showmanship — and fans can’t stop talking about it.
